The promise of Christ’s advent shows how great He is. He came once to sorrow and shame. The way the Lord was treated is still a scandal. Nobody ever CAME like Jesus came. He came from Godhead to manhood, and put on a garment of flesh. What a coming! A few shepherds talked about it on that first Christmas, but the whole world talks about it today, and more every day. Jesus knew it would all take Him to Calvary. Terrible treatment was handed out to Him. He was “despised and rejected of men, a man of sorrow…” No hate could have been worse. This world inflicted wounds upon His very heart. Then He went away. Who could blame Him? He carried the scars of hideous torture and presented His injuries back home in glory, which He had ‘received in the house of His friends’ (Zechariah 13:6). They never heal. He is ‘the Lamb as it had been slain’ (Revelation 5:6). Yet, despite His rejection, He is coming back! That tells you who He is. O what a Christ! His generous and forgiving love for a sinful world. It makes us stand back speechless in amazement. He wants to come back and has planned it ever since He left us, like the Bridegroom who longs for the Bride. His love burns on. He can never forget us. His heart is a bright star in the dark night of this world. His love did not burn itself out on the Cross. Calvary is not an extinct volcano. Our Gospel message is about Christ crucified, but if it leaves out the fact that the Crucified One is also the Coming One, we are left with only an abstract theory. He couldn’t be what He once was and not come back. He must come back to finish what He began. After all, His first coming won our hearts. He made us want Him. He drew us. He set us longing. We love Him. He has no intention of disappointing us. “Even so come Lord Jesus.” (Rev. 22,20) God bless you. Your Friend Isaac Roger
